Kodra

Kodra is a village located in Tanda tehsil of Ambedkar Nagar district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 8km away from sub-district headquarter Tanda (tehsildar office) and 29km away from district headquarter Ambedkarnagar. As per 2009 stats, Kodra village is also a gram panchayat.

About Kodra

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Kodra is 167293. The village spans a total geographical area of 305 hectares. Tanda is nearest town to Kodra village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 8km away.

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Kodra village:

  • The total population of Kodra village is around 2,196, including approximately 1,080 males and 1,116 females, with a sex ratio of 1033 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 285 children aged 0–6 years in Kodra village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Kodra village has 356 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Kodra village is about 61.89%, with male literacy at 70.83% and female literacy at 53.23%.
  • There are around 383 households in Kodra village.

Connectivity of Kodra

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Kodra. As per the 2011 stats, Kodra had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
